This is Chongqing, a city of 8 million, center of a "Municipality of Chongqing" that has 38 million.  I cleaned the skies a little in Photoshop.  This is the Jialing River, that a few miles below merges into the Yangtze.  It's on hills, with high-rise apartments everywhere, almost like Hong Kong.  We also went to see giant pandas in the zoo, see below.   Click to see a large image.

The old Ciqi Kou town is listed, in guidebooks, as 9 miles West of Chongqing, but it has been surrounded by the growing city.  Lovely shops and restaurants, strange smells, on a hill over the Jialing river.  Click to see a larger image.

The old China, and new, behind.  The Baolun Si temple, the only one of five left in the old Ciqi Kou town, on a steep hill, overlooks the Jialing river and blocks of newly built apartments on the other side.  Just below, with a cement post in the river, is the current start-point of the (landscaped) riverside motorway, which will soon be extending to the left, under and past the old temple.  Click to see a larger image.
